Analysing your business - Part 5



Having said all that I have in the past blog posts, trade shows are the best times to see and meet brands and industry people that you do not normally or regularly see, so make sure you have enough time scheduled in to see them. Do some searching on the internet prior to shows and make sure you have read your trade magazines. It is also the time to see the trends and colours for the oncoming seasons. So walk the isles, look out for newness and talk to the new brands or brands you do not currently deal with, you never know you may be pleasantly surprised. Introduce your self to the trade magazines ask them what they have found that new and exciting and find out all the latest news. You need to know what is going on in your industry, Be pro active, think ahead...
